    Title: The Power of Small Acts of Kindness。
    In our fast-paced world, it's easy to overlook the significance of small acts of kindness. However, these seemingly insignificant gestures hold immense power in shaping our lives and the lives of those around us.
    First and foremost, small acts of kindness have the remarkable ability to brighten someone's day. Whether it's holding the door open for a stranger, offering a genuine compliment, or simply sharing a smile, these small gestures can make a big difference in someone's mood and outlook. In a world where negativity often dominates headlines and social media feeds, a small act of kindness can serve as a ray of sunshine, reminding people that there is still goodness and compassion in the world.
    Moreover, small acts of kindness can create a ripple effect that extends far beyond the initial interaction. When we extend kindness to others, it inspires them to pay it forward, creati
ng a chain reaction of positivity. For example, imagine a scenario where someone witnesses a stranger helping an elderly person carry their groceries. Inspired by this act of kindness, the observer may be prompted to perform their own act of kindness later in the day, setting off a chain reaction of goodwill that spreads throughout the community.
    Furthermore, small acts of kindness have the power to foster connections and build stronger communities. In today's digitally connected yet emotionally disconnected world, genuine human connections are more important than ever. When we engage in acts of kindness, whether it's volunteering at a local shelter or simply lending a listening ear to a friend in need, we strengthen the bonds that tie us together as human beings. These connections form the foundation of supportive communities where people feel valued, understood, and cared for.
    Additionally, small acts of kindness can have a profound impact on our own well-being. Numerous studies have shown that helping others can boost our mood, reduce stress, and increase overall happiness. When we engage in acts of kindness, our brains release feel-g
ood chemicals like dopamine and oxytocin, which contribute to a sense of fulfillment and satisfaction. In essence, by helping others, we are also helping ourselves, creating a positive feedback loop of kindness and well-being.
    In conclusion, while small acts of kindness may seem insignificant in the grand scheme of things, they possess a remarkable power to make the world a better place. From brightening someone's day to fostering connections and improving our own well-being, the impact of these gestures cannot be overstated. So let us each strive to incorporate more kindness into our daily lives, for in doing so, we not only uplift others but also enrich our own lives in the process. As the saying goes, "No act of kindness, no matter how small, is ever wasted."
